The Northwest Arkansas Food Bank has begun a four-week Produce Pilot Program to get fresh produce to allied agencies quicker.


The test trial, which began Aug. 28, is being tried at Samaritan Community centers in Rogers and Springdale as well as the Senior Center in Springdale and Helping Hands in Bentonville. The trial agencies will be receiving fruits, vegetables, bread and bakery items.


“Instead of bringing the produce from retail stores back to the Food Bank for distribution, we’re picking up it up and taking it straight to the test agencies,” said Carrie Harlow, chief operating officer at the Food Bank.


“It improves the shelf life of the produce and we’re able to distribute on the same day,” she said. “So far it’s been successful. The second week of the trial, we doubled what was dropped off the previous week. The clients were loving it so much.”


If the trial works, the Food Bank hopes to expand it to other agencies, she added.


Lori Proud, director of the Springdale Senior Center, said the seniors were thrilled with the program.


The center found several things it could use for Meals on Wheels that will result in a cost savings.


“The seniors have been in each day telling us how much they enjoyed the food,” Proud said. “One lady said she was able to make three meals out of the fruit and veggies she got. Another lady said she had the best veggie dinner.


Proud’s favorite comment was a lady who said, “Oh my, are those Bing cherries? Those are my favorite but I can never afford them so I just walk on by.”


“Thanks to you she got them for free,” said Proud. “I know it is extra work for each of you but it made a huge difference in the life of our seniors.

Courtney Wrinkle, market coordinator at the Samaritan Community Center, thanked the Food Bank for the fresh produce.

“I know our clients this week will be really excited,” she added.
